What Is a Normal Intracranial Pressure (ICP) Level?

Intracranial pressure (ICP) represents the pressure within the skull, exerted by the brain tissue, cerebrospinal fluid (CSF), and blood. Maintaining a stable ICP is fundamental for the healthy functioning of the brain. An imbalance in this pressure can have significant effects on brain health.

Understanding Intracranial Pressure

The skull encases the brain in a rigid, fixed space. Within this confined area, three main components contribute to intracranial pressure: brain tissue, cerebrospinal fluid that surrounds and cushions the brain and spinal cord, and blood volume. The relationship between these components and the pressure inside the skull is described by the Monro-Kellie doctrine. It states that if the volume of one component increases, there must be a compensatory decrease in the volume of another to maintain stable pressure. For example, if brain tissue volume increases due to swelling, the body may reduce CSF or blood volume to prevent a significant rise in pressure.

Normal Range of Intracranial Pressure

For healthy adults in a resting, supine position, normal intracranial pressure is between 7 and 15 millimeters of mercury (mmHg). This range ensures adequate blood flow to the brain while preventing excessive force on brain structures. While 15 mmHg is the upper limit of normal, values up to 20 mmHg may be tolerated before treatment, though pressures above 15 mmHg are often considered abnormal.

Normal ICP values vary based on age and activity. Infants have lower normal ICP ranges, between 1 to 6 mmHg. Brief increases in ICP occur during everyday activities such as coughing, sneezing, or straining, which momentarily elevate pressure. These fluctuations are temporary, and the pressure quickly returns to the normal resting range.

Recognizing Abnormal Intracranial Pressure

Abnormal intracranial pressure can manifest as either elevated (high) or decreased (low) pressure, each with distinct symptoms. When ICP is elevated, symptoms include a persistent headache, which may worsen in the morning or when lying down. Nausea and vomiting are also common. Visual disturbances, such as blurred vision, double vision, or temporary loss of vision, can occur due to pressure on the optic nerves. Other signs include altered mental status, ranging from drowsiness to confusion, or more severe changes in consciousness.

Conversely, abnormally low intracranial pressure presents with a characteristic positional headache. This headache intensifies when an individual sits or stands upright and improves or resolves when lying flat. Alongside the headache, symptoms can include dizziness, changes in hearing (muffled sounds or tinnitus), and sometimes double vision. These symptoms arise because the brain may sag slightly within the skull due to insufficient cushioning from cerebrospinal fluid.

When to Seek Medical Attention

Any suspicion of abnormal intracranial pressure warrants prompt medical evaluation. If symptoms such as a sudden, severe headache, changes in vision, confusion, or weakness appear, seek emergency medical care. These symptoms can indicate a serious underlying condition that requires immediate attention to prevent potentially harmful complications.

Early diagnosis and intervention are important for managing conditions related to abnormal ICP. While some symptoms can be subtle at first, their progression or severity can increase rapidly. Consulting a healthcare professional without delay allows for proper assessment and timely management, which can impact outcomes and prevent long-term neurological damage.
